Who is Kenneth Copeland?
Before we dive into Kenneth Copeland's net worth, let's briefly introduce the man behind the ministry. Born on December 6, 1936, in Lubbock, Texas, Kenneth Max Copeland is an American televangelist and author. He is the founder of Kenneth Copeland Ministries (KCM), which was established in 1967. Copeland is best known for his charismatic preaching style and his teachings on the prosperity gospel.

Kenneth Copeland's Controversies
Kenneth Copeland's wealth and lifestyle have not gone unnoticed, and he has faced criticism and controversy over the years. Some of the most notable controversies include:
- Private Jet Usage: Critics have questioned Copeland's use of private jets, arguing that it's an extravagant expense for a religious leader. Copeland, however, defends his use of private jets, stating that it allows him to travel more efficiently and effectively for his ministry. - Teaching on Money and Prosperity: Copeland's teachings on money and prosperity, which are central to the prosperity gospel, have been heavily criticized. His detractors argue that these teachings are more about wealth accumulation than spiritual growth. - Relationship with Donald Trump: Copeland was a vocal supporter of former U.S. President Donald Trump. His endorsement of Trump, along with other prominent evangelical leaders, has been a subject of controversy and criticism.
